Full nutrition facts (per 100 g)

NutrientPer 100 g% DV*
Macronutrients
Protein 12.4 g 25%
Total Fat 17.8 g 23%
Saturated Fat 1 g 5%
Carbohydrate 55 g 20%
Dietary Fiber 41.9 g 150%
Total Sugars
Minerals
Sodium 35 mg 2%
Potassium 1,267 mg 27%
Calcium 709 mg 55%
Iron 16.3 mg 91%
Magnesium 330 mg 79%
Vitamins
Vitamin C 21 mg 23%
Vitamin A 0 mcg 0%
Vitamin D 0 mcg 0%
Other
Cholesterol 0 mg 0%

* Percent of the Daily Value (Daily Value, based on a 2,000 kcal diet).

Data source: USDA FoodData Central. Values are per 100 g of edible portion and are reference figures — they vary by variety, preparation and brand. Last updated: 2026-04-30.
